Tax cuts, first homebuyer loan scheme to be expanded in Federal Budget

Personal income tax cuts for workers and an expansion of the first homebuyer loans scheme for new homes will be announced on Tuesday night in a budget focused on creating jobs.News.com.au has confirmed the Morrison Government is extending the First Home Buyer Loan Scheme to support the residential construction industry and help first home buyers to enter the market sooner.
